Milton to hold electronics recycling day

Milton is going green on Saint Patrick’s Day by partnering with Verizon Wireless on an electronics recycling day from 7:30 a.m. to 2 p.m. Wednesday at the company’s local headquarters at 1 Verizon Place.

Acceptable items include computers, telephones, shredders and electronic toys. Not acceptable are refrigerators, freezers and televisions. To see a complete list of acceptable and non-acceptable items, go to www.cityofmiltonga.us.

Participants can win a kit that includes water-saving items such as a reduced water shower head and bathroom aerators. Winners will be randomly selected.
